Abstract

1375021 Measuring transparent material with fibre optics guides COMPAGNIE DES COMPTEURS 5 Nov 1971 [6 Nov 1970 15 Jan 1971] 51519/71 Heading G1A The thickness or distance away of transparent material 64, Fig.5, having front 61 and rear faces 61' both capable of reflecting radiation is measured by a fibre optics arrangement consisting of a central guide 60 directing radiation on to the surfaces and two receiving guides 62 1 , 62 2 directing the reflected light on to corresponding detectors 63 1 , 632 (photo-diodes or photo-transistors). One radiation receiving guide 62 1 receives radiation from the front face 61 (plus possibly some radiation from the back face, depending upon the material's thickness and the reflectivity of the back face); the other light receiving guide 62 2 is spaced transversely from the central guide 60 and receives radiation from the back face 71 only. The areas of the light receiving faces and/or the gain of amplifiers 66 1 , 66 2 of the detectors 63 1 , 63 2 are adjusted so that the linear portion Figs.5A (not shown) of the characteristic curve of intensity of light received versus distance away from the emitting face has the same slope (sensitivity) in order that subtraction in a differential amplifier 65 of the two detector output signals (which both provide a distance measurement) may provide an output signal directly proportional to the material's thickness. In a modification, Fig.6, an extra light receiving guide 122 2 adjacent the central guide 110 is used to help eliminate the effect of the inner most receiving guide 122 1 receiving light reflected from the back face 111'. The detector output signals of the two adjacent inner most receiving guides are subtracted from one another and the "compensated" resulting signal is fed to a further differential amplifier 132 which also receives the outer most guide's detector's 113 n+1 output. A series of light receiving guides Figs.4, 4B (not shown) for receiving radiation reflected from the back face may be provided to cope with a series of possible thickness ranges of the material since the position of the guide 122 n+ 1 used depends upon the expected thickness of the material, and the guide used should preferably be one where this thickness in the central portion of the linear part of its characteristic curve. Since the detector's outputs are linear over only a portion of their characteristic curves, two adjacent series of guides Fig.4B (not shown), (whose light receiving ends are formed in two lines individual members of which in one line are staggered relative to corresponding members in the other line), may be provided so that the instrument can be used continuously within a range without any periodic portions having to be omitted due to non-linearity of the output signals. A detailed mathematical analysis of the physics of the operation of the apparatus is disclosed.
